850W 80+ Gold ATX 3.0 Power Supply
The RTX 3080 exhibits massive transient power spikes that trip Over Current Protection (OCP) or prevent the motherboard from sensing stable power during the POST sequence. An ATX 3.0 compliant unit handles these millisecond-long spikes more effectively than older units. This solves the failure by providing the stable 300W+ instantaneous draw required for the GPU's VRM to initialize.

VESA Certified DisplayPort 1.4a Cable
RTX 30-series cards frequently experience a 'handshake' hang with high-refresh-rate monitors during bootup. A high-quality VESA certified cable ensures that the DisplayID data is transmitted correctly to the GPU's firmware during the initial polling. This resolves 'No Signal' boot loops that are actually completed POSTs hidden by a failed display link.

PCIe 4.0 X16 Riser Cable
Many 3080 installations use vertical mounts. If a PCIe 3.0 riser is used with a motherboard and GPU both set to PCIe 4.0, the signal integrity is insufficient for the POST handshake, resulting in no display. Upgrading to a shielded 4.0-rated cable restores the high-frequency communication path required for the Ampere architecture's bus speed.
